bookbabe Posted July 19, 2009 #2 Share Posted July 19, 2009 I've never tried it, but based on the fact that it's about halfway to Rum Point, and a taxi to Rum Point is about $80 US, I say you're looking at $40 each way maybe? That's just a guess, though...I could be way off. Drew? Any ideas? And you're going to have to make arrangements in advance for the return trip, or pay the taxi to wait, since there likely won't be any in the area to flag down when you're done. The buses do go past there, so that's maybe a cheaper option. Or, just rent a car and drive there. It's likely cheaper than the taxi.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
drew sailbum Posted July 23, 2009 #3 Share Posted July 23, 2009 I would more or less agree with bookbabe's conclusions. The Lighthouse Restaurant is in Breaker's - approximately half way to Rum Point. Taxi fare would likely be around $35 to $40 one way. I would suggest renting a car and heading out to Rum Point or the Botanic Park for the morning and then doubling back to the Lighthouse Restaurant for lunch.
